§ 25-7-403 — Commission - rule-making for wood-burning stoves

Colorado·Title 25 Public·Art. Air Quality Control
(1)The commission shall promulgate rules and regulations to carry out the provisions of this part 4 relating to wood-burning stoves in conformity with the provisions and procedures specified in article 4 of title 24, C.R.S., and which shall become effective only as provided in said article.
(2)(a) In promulgating such rules and regulations, the commission shall:
(I)Set emission performance standards for new wood stoves;
(II)Establish criteria and procedures for testing new wood stoves for compliance with the emission performance standards;
(III)Prescribe the form and content of the emission performance label to be attached to a new wood stove meeting the emission performance standards;
